Expert Outlet Installation in Simi Valley, CA

Pacific West Construction Specialists, Inc. handles outlet installation for Simi Valley homeowners who need more power where they use it most. We install new receptacles in kitchens, home offices, garages, bathrooms, and outdoor areas. Every outlet is wired to code and load-tested before we leave. Many Simi Valley homes built in the 1990s and 2000s carry 100-amp panels and older circuit layouts that were not designed for today's appliances, EV chargers, or home office setups. When we add a new outlet, we evaluate the circuit it will sit on first. If the existing wiring cannot safely carry the added load, we tell you before we start. We also install GFCI outlets in wet and outdoor locations, which California code requires in kitchens, bathrooms, garages, and exterior spots. Outlet Installation FAQ

Common questions about outlet installation in Simi Valley, CA.

We can install an outlet in most locations, but the right spot depends on your existing circuit capacity and wall framing. Our electricians assess the circuit first to confirm it can handle the added load safely.

Yes, California electrical code requires GFCI protection in kitchens, bathrooms, garages, and outdoor locations. Pacific West Construction Specialists, Inc. installs and tests GFCI outlets to confirm they trip and reset correctly.

In many cases, yes, if the existing circuits have enough capacity to support additional receptacles. We check the load on your panel and circuits before recommending the right approach for your home.

California requires electrical work to be performed by or under the supervision of a licensed C-10 contractor. Hiring a licensed electrician protects you from code violations and keeps your home insurable.

We install standard 15-amp and 20-amp receptacles, GFCI outlets, 240V outlets for appliances, and outdoor-rated outlets. The right type depends on the location and what you plan to plug in.

A warm wall plate, a outlet that sparks, or one that stops holding a plug firmly are signs it needs replacement, not just a new install. Call us and we will inspect the outlet and the circuit it sits on.
